Comprehensive Definitions & Senses
2 senses- 1
Any sport or recreational activity that takes place on or in water.
"Kayaking and wakeboarding are popular types of watersport enjoyed by many during the summer." - 2
A category of sports that includes activities such as swimming, surfing, and sailing.
"The local club offers lessons in various watersport activities for beginners."

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ology
The term 'watersport' combines 'water', derived from Old English 'wæter', and 'sport', from Old French 'desport', meaning 'to carry away'. The term evolved in the late 20th century to encompass various recreational activities conducted on or in water.

View all stories →How Are Palisade Cells Adapted for Photosynthesis (and Why Are They Called 'Palisade')?
Palisade mesophyll cells are column-shaped, densely packed with chloroplasts, and positioned near the leaf's upper surface to maximize light absorption for photosynthesis. Their name comes from the French word for a defensive fence of wooden stakes, referencing their tightly aligned, upright cellular structure.
